How To Make Corned Beef and Cabbage

The Instant Pot makes this Irish meal easy! Be sure to set aside enough time for this recipe as the cook time is a little longer on this one and you’ll need about 2 hours from start to finish to make this corned beef and cabbage. The end result is so delicious!!

Corned beef and cabbage is made with a corned beef brisket cooked along with onions, garlic, potatoes, carrots and cabbage. For this recipe, we will cook the brisket first and then cook the potatoes, carrots and cabbage at the end so we don’t overcook them and end up with mushy vegetables! It only takes 3 minutes cook time at the end though so it is super easy and fast to cook them!

 

add onion and garlic to Instant Pot

 

We start by dicing onions and garlic and adding them to the Instant Pot along with some bay leaves.

 

pour chicken or beef broth in Instant Pot

 

Many traditional corned beef recipes utilize dark beer as the cooking liquid. However, this gluten-free version relies on chicken or beef broth instead. I recommend using a quality bone broth for the best flavor and nutrition content.

 

place beef brisket on trivet of Instant Pot

 

You’ll want to place the corned beef brisket fat side down on the trivet in the Instant Pot. Then season with spice back, sea salt and black pepper to your liking.

 

cut up potatoes, carrots and cabbage

 

While the beef brisket is cooking you can slice your carrots, cabbage and potatoes. We will be cooking these at the end.

 

corned beef cabbage recipe

 

Once the beef brisket is cooked, allow pressure to naturally release for 10 minutes. If you skip this and do a quick release your meat will be dry! Remove beef brisket using the trivet (and pot holders – it will be hot!). Set aside and keep warm. Put carrots, potatoes and cabbage in Instant Pot and cook for 3 minutes.

Instant Pot Corned Beef and Cabbage

Sarah
Many traditional corned beef recipes utilize dark beer as the cooking liquid. However, this gluten-free version relies on chicken or beef broth instead.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our 28 minutes
Natural Release 10 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 53 minutes
Course Dinner
Cuisine Irish

Equipment

  • Instant Pot

Ingredients
  

  • 6 large cloves garlic peeled and minced
  • 2 small or 1 medium yellow onions chopped
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 2 cups chicken or beef broth preferably organic
  • 1 cup water
  • 2½ - 4 pound corned beef brisket with spice pack
  • Sea salt and black pepper to taste
  • 5 large carrots cut into strips
  • 1 lbs. red potatoes quartered
  • ½ large cabbage head sliced

Instructions
 

  • Add garlic, onion, and bay leaves to Instant Pot® container and pour the broth and water on top. Place the trivet that comes with the Instant Pot® inside the container with the handles positioned up for easy removal.
  • Place the brisket fat-side down on the trivet and season with salt and black pepper, to taste. Sprinkle the spice packet that came with the brisket on top.
  • Add the lid and lock into place. Set the vent to “Sealing” and select the “Manual” button. Adjust to the “High” setting and set the cook time to 85 minutes.
  • When cook time is complete, allow the pressure to release naturally for 10 minutes before doing a quick release on any remaining pressure. Remove brisket by carefully lifting the trivet out by the handles (using potholders) and transfer to a platter. Set aside and keep warm.
  • Return the trivet to the Instant Pot® and add the carrots, potatoes, and cabbage on top. Cover and lock lid into place. Set the vent to “Sealing” and select the “Manual” button. Adjust cook time to 3 minutes.
  • When cook time is complete, allow the pressure to release naturally for 5 minutes before doing a quick release on the remaining pressure.
  • Transfer the cooked vegetables to the serving platter with the corned beef. Slice the beef against the grain and serve immediately along with the vegetables. Enjoy!

Frequently Asked Questions

Do you have to rinse the corned beef brisket before cooking?

No, you don’t have to rinse it. You can opt to rinse it to remove some salt and you will get a more mild flavor but it is not required to rinse it before cooking.

 

How do you know when corn beef is done cooking?

Corned beef is made with a less tender cut of meat so longer cooking will produce more tender meat, however, corned beef is safe to eat once the internal temperature reaches 145 degrees F.

 

What do you serve with corned beef and cabbage?

I love this recipe because it makes a whole meal with the potatoes and carrots and you don’t need to serve anything else with it! If you desire you can serve a salad or another Irish favorite food with it! Maybe an Irish soda bread!!

 

What condiment goes with corned beef?

Mustard is the perfect condiment to go with corned beef! Choose a gourmet, quality mustard over the traditional yellow squirt bottle fare!
